I understand the appeal of finding free legal options for popular books like 'Fifty Shades Darker'. While the book is widely available for purchase, there are legitimate ways to access it without cost. Many public libraries offer digital lending services through apps like Libby or OverDrive, where you can borrow the eBook for free with a library card. Some libraries even partner with services like Hoopla, which provides access to a vast collection of titles. Additionally, platforms like Project Gutenberg and Open Library focus on providing free access to books, though they primarily host older or public domain works. For newer titles like 'Fifty Shades Darker', signing up for free trials on subscription services like Kindle Unlimited or Scribd might be a temporary solution. Always ensure you’re using authorized platforms to support authors and avoid piracy.

How can I legally read Fifty Shades Darker online in full?

49 Answers2026-07-10 01:48:51
Google Play Books is a legitimate option that sometimes flies under the radar. You can buy it there and read it in their app or on a web browser. It's a good alternative if you prefer not to use Amazon's ecosystem for your digital purchases. Your purchase is tied to your Google account, so it's easy to access from any Android device or computer.

Where can I read Fifty Shades Darker novel online free?

2 Answers2025-08-05 15:42:02
I totally get wanting to dive into 'Fifty Shades Darker' without breaking the bank, but here’s the thing—finding it legally for free is tough. Publishers and authors put a ton of work into these books, and they deserve compensation. That said, there are ways to read it without paying upfront. Your local library might have digital copies through apps like Libby or OverDrive. You just need a library card, which is free. Some libraries even let you sign up online. Another option is checking out legit platforms that offer free trials, like Kindle Unlimited or Audible. You can often snag a 30-day trial, read the book, and cancel before getting charged. Just make sure to set a reminder so you don’t forget. Pirate sites might pop up in searches, but they’re sketchy—full of malware, and it’s unfair to the author. Plus, supporting piracy hurts the industry we all love. If you’re tight on cash, libraries and trials are the way to go.
